Chronic Disease Management in Emergencies

When disasters strike, the immediate focus is on acute injuries and infectious disease outbreaks. But for millions of people living with chronic conditions like diabetes, heart disease, asthma, and hypertension, an emergency can mean a dangerous and often deadly interruption in care. While these conditions may not seem as urgent as traumatic injuries, a lack of consistent management can lead to severe complications, hospitalizations, or even fatalities.

The Hidden Crisis in Disasters

Unlike traumatic injuries that demand immediate medical attention, chronic diseases require continuous management. Patients rely on regular medication, specialized medical devices, and access to healthcare providers to keep their conditions stable. When an emergency disrupts this delicate balance, the consequences can escalate quickly:

  • Medication shortages – Supply chain breakdowns, pharmacy closures, and transportation challenges can make it impossible for patients to access essential medications like insulin, blood pressure medicine, or inhalers. Many patients depend on specific brands or formulations, and substitutions may not always be available or effective.

  • Limited access to healthcare providers – Many healthcare facilities close or become overwhelmed, leaving chronic disease patients without access to routine care, prescription refills, or check-ins with medical professionals. This is particularly concerning for conditions that require frequent monitoring, such as diabetes or heart failure.

  • Disruptions in power and medical equipment use – People who rely on medical devices such as oxygen concentrators, dialysis machines, CPAP machines, or insulin pumps face life-threatening risks when power outages or infrastructure failures prevent them from using their essential equipment.

  • Increased stress and environmental triggers – Disasters can worsen conditions like asthma or heart disease due to exposure to smoke, poor air quality, and extreme temperatures. Stress and lack of sleep can further aggravate conditions such as high blood pressure and autoimmune diseases, leading to flare-ups or serious episodes.

The Cascading Effects of System Failures

When chronic disease management breaks down in an emergency, the ripple effects can be felt across the entire healthcare system. Hospitals and emergency rooms, already burdened with disaster-related injuries, must also handle a surge of patients experiencing complications from unmanaged chronic conditions.

For example, individuals with diabetes may suffer from dangerously high blood sugar levels due to missed insulin doses. People with high blood pressure or heart disease may experience spikes that increase their risk of heart attacks or strokes. Those dependent on dialysis can face life-threatening fluid buildup if their treatments are delayed.

Case Studies: The Real-World Impact

In the aftermath of Hurricane Maria in Puerto Rico, thousands of people with diabetes faced severe health complications due to a lack of insulin access and refrigeration. Many were forced to ration their medication or go without it entirely, leading to emergency room visits, increased rates of diabetes-related amputations, and life-threatening health crises. People with high blood pressure struggled without their medication, increasing their risk of stroke and heart failure. Additionally, individuals reliant on oxygen concentrators or ventilators suffered as power outages rendered their equipment useless, leaving them unable to breathe properly.

Similarly, during winter storms in Texas, dialysis patients struggled to receive life-saving treatments when clinics closed due to power outages. Without regular dialysis, toxins accumulated in their bodies, leading to severe complications, emergency hospitalizations, and fatalities. Many patients attempted to seek care in overwhelmed emergency departments, but hospitals already dealing with weather-related injuries were unable to meet the demand. This situation underscored the critical need for backup power solutions and alternative treatment sites during widespread power failures.

Beyond natural disasters, the COVID-19 pandemic also highlighted how fragile chronic disease management can be during prolonged emergencies. Many patients delayed or avoided routine medical care due to lockdowns, overwhelmed healthcare facilities, or fear of exposure to the virus. The result was an increase in undiagnosed and untreated conditions, leading to worsening complications that required more intensive interventions later. People with heart disease, for example, faced higher rates of severe heart issues due to missed monitoring and treatment adjustments. Meanwhile, disruptions in medication supply chains forced patients to switch to alternative drugs, some of which were less effective or had different side effects, further complicating disease management.

These case studies illustrate how system failures in emergencies disproportionately impact people with chronic conditions. Without targeted preparedness measures, already vulnerable populations will continue to face avoidable risks, further straining healthcare systems and leading to preventable health crises.

What Needs to Change?

To prevent chronic disease care from collapsing during disasters, emergency managers and public health professionals must incorporate proactive strategies to ensure continuity of care. Key considerations include:

  • Strengthening emergency medication access – Stockpiling essential medications at community hubs, ensuring pharmacies have emergency dispensing protocols, and improving communication around prescription refills during disasters.

  • Expanding telehealth and mobile clinics – Providing virtual or mobile healthcare access can help bridge gaps when physical facilities are unavailable, especially for those who need routine monitoring or check-ins with medical professionals.

  • Integrating chronic disease care into emergency preparedness – Disaster response plans must account for chronic disease management, not just trauma care. Shelters and relief efforts should include provisions for those with ongoing medical needs, including refrigeration for medications and charging stations for medical devices.

  • Ensuring resilient medical supply chains – Building redundancy into supply chains can prevent critical shortages during crises. Partnerships between governments, healthcare providers, and pharmaceutical companies can help ensure that medication distribution remains stable even in the face of disruptions.

  • Community-based preparedness efforts – Educating individuals with chronic conditions on emergency preparedness, such as maintaining extra medication supplies, knowing alternative care locations, and having backup power options, can help mitigate risks when disaster strikes.

Strengthening Community Resilience

The breakdown of chronic disease management in emergencies is not just a side issue—it is a major public health challenge that needs stronger attention. By integrating chronic disease care into disaster planning and response efforts, emergency managers can help reduce unnecessary suffering, prevent avoidable complications, and strengthen overall community resilience.
